Note: This is a student edition and does not contain the breadth of material found in the teacher's editions, which are sold exclusively through the publisher.
Take Rigorous, Standards-Based Nonfiction Study to a Higher Level
The Reading Informational Texts series eliminates the need for hours of outside research and provides you with exactly what the Common Core State Standards (CCSS) require.
Each student workbook contains a variety of reading passages selected using CCSS-designated methods, accompanied by brief background materials, margin notes, short-answer and essay questions, and contextually defined vocabulary words.
Using the teacher's edition, available through the publisher, you can guide your students through a close reading of each work and fulfill the standards for reading: informational text.
Passages include:
  • Patrick Henry: Speech to the Second Virginia Convention
  • Margaret Chase Smith: Remarks to the Senate in Support of a Declaration of Conscience
  • Ernie Pyle: The Death of Captain Waskow
  • Harriet Jacobs: Incidents in the Life of a Slave Girl (Chapters I and II)
  • John Fitzgerald Kennedy: 1961 Inaugural Address
  • NASA: Light Emitting Diodes Bring Relief to Young Cancer Patients
  • Justice Frank Murphy: Dissenting Opinion in the Case of Korematsu v. United States
